Baltimore Orioles @ Boston Red Sox

Odds courtesy of FanDuel Sportsbook. Check out our MLB betting sites for more betting opportunities.

My Pick: Over 10 (-110)

The Boston Red Sox will host the Baltimore Orioles, in a critical weekend series for the visitors. Baltimore is trying to stay at the top of the AL East and clinch the division. They’re creating a lot of separation with a 3.5-game lead heading into Boston, but no gap is safe with the Rays' talent across the board. 

These divisional foes have only played six games against each other this season, which is rare in the final month. The final four games will be played at the end of the month at Camden Yards. Boston has been successful against the Orioles in 2023, as they’re tied 3-3. 

The reason the Red Sox can play with the Orioles is because of their bats. To keep up with Baltimore, a team must be very efficient on offense, and the Red Sox have displayed this talent at Fenway Park all year. 

The Red Sox are batting .283 as a team with a .349 OBP in Boston this season. Their road dropoff is vast, so a primary reason we’re taking the over of 10 runs is because this game is at Fenway Park. 

Baltimore’s offense has been consistent no matter the venue. The Orioles are batting .256 with a .322 OBP on the road. We believe both offenses will show up on Friday night with the pitching combination on the hill.

Kyle Bradish will pitch for the Orioles. He is 10-6 with a 3.03 ERA and a 1.11 WHIP. He has been very strong in 139.2 innings, but slightly worse on the road. Additionally, he hasn’t been great against Boston. 

Bradish only made one start against the Red Sox, but he allowed seven earned runs in 2.1 innings. The Red Sox hit .615 off the pitcher in those innings. No teams have hit Bradish like this in 2023. 

Tanner Houck will take the ball for Boston. There is nothing special about the right-hander, who is 4-8 with a 5.07 ERA and a 1.31 WHIP. The combination of the pitchers and offensive firepower makes this the perfect game to take the over. 

Arizona Diamondbacks @ Chicago Cubs

Odds courtesy of FanDuel Sportsbook.

My Pick: Under 8 (-110)

The Arizona Diamondbacks and Chicago Cubs both have a lot of pop, but we believe we’ll see limited runs on Friday. The wind is blowing in at Wrigley Field, which makes it very tough for balls to leave the yard. Additionally, the early start on a Friday should affect the bats for Arizona, as they’re not used to playing in this time range. 

The pitching matchup is headlined by Zac Gallen, who will take the mound for Arizona. Gallen is 14-7 with a 3.48 ERA and a 1.11 WHIP. Over 178.2 innings, he has allowed just 161 hits with 186 strikeouts. 

He hasn’t shown many weaknesses this season. He is coming off two rough starts against the Orioles and Dodgers, but this is understandable. Pitching at Wrigley Field with the wind blowing in will be perfect for Gallen to get back on track. 

Jameson Taillon will throw for the Cubs, and he has been average this season. The pitcher is 7-9 with a 5.73 ERA and a 1.35 WHIP. There have been innings where he has fallen apart, but he can also deal when he is on his game. 

Arizona’s offense hasn’t been that strong in the second half of the season, so it’s an ideal matchup for Taillon. Look for limited runs to be scored and for this game to stay under the eight-run total.
